Rajasthan Royals at their globalising best today. An Englishman born in South Africa is opening with a batsman from Madhya Pradesh. The players who follow represent the following teams: Vidarbha, Baroda, Western Australia/Notts, Bengal, Himachal Pradesh, Hampshire/Victoria, Mumbai, Gujarat and South Australia. Now someone please tell me why they are called the Rajasthan Royals?

It is so unlike last year
IPL season 3 - 2010
1. Ex-ICL players are part of the tournament.
2. The tournament is happening in India despite security concerns and subtle threats from foreign players and Federation of International Cricketers' Associations(FICA).
3. No Pakistan cricketer is playing. There are many theories doing the rounds for their non-participation but that is part of another story
4. All teams look formidable to go through to semis - It is still early days but last year you could still count out few teams.
Like last year there is still lot of buzz and moolah. Let the best team win...
